"..IN THE IMAGE OF GOD WAS ADAM CREATED; MALE & FEMALE DID GOD CREATE ADAM.* "




Not just two animals in a symbiotic relationship, each run by impulses designed to aid those animals in the survival of their species.


But two unique creatures (baby, no, fetal gods -i.e. able to, and meant to, look at the overall view, and make choices for the best (of the whole she-bang, even choices that might bring on their own hurt). These last choices (that are best for the whole she-bang, but are for their own hurt), if done with a certain spirit of "seeking glory, honour, and immortality", or "trusting the IS-ness, behind the whole universe", or "an implicit connectedness to all goodness" function as the pathway, the test, the way forward, the canal of pain and suffering down which they must travel in order to get "born", to graduate to being a baby god, in a new-creation body, immortal (like Jesus's resurrection body).


This special relationship (between a male/female image/likeness of YHWH/Elohim) is a key experience which is meant to be a training process, as well as to act as a metaphor, designed to produce many progeny, in all senses, physically, emotionally, idea-ly.



I heard someone call it a TWOMAN (said as 2 MAN, but when spelled out, it beautifully, both overlaps & retains connotations of all three concepts: TWO, WOMAN & MAN)



The trick seems to me to be to learn to freely give my personal identity & creative, loving, & regenerative powers to the life of this mystical creature that cannot be (physically) seen. 


The participation in, and experience of, the building & creation of this real but unseen ephemoral creature is an experience of a metaphor designed to lead one on to something bigger than one's individual self. Something freely entered into by smaller selves, and that will give each self entering an experience of a corporate, or bigger, kind of one-ness, & selfhood, from which all other "ones", or selves are birthed.





* After "day 5":


..God made the wild animals according to their kinds, the livestock according to their kinds, and all the creatures that move along the ground according to their kinds. And God saw that it was good. 


Then God said, 

‘Let us make ADAM in our image, in our likeness, 

so as to rule over the fish in the sea and the birds in the sky, over the livestock and all the wild animals, and over all the creatures that move along the ground.’ 


So God created ADAM in his own image, 

in the image of God was ADAM created; 

male and female did God create ADAM. 


God blessed ADAM and said, ‘Be fruitful and increase in number; fill the earth and subdue it. Rule over the fish in the sea and the birds in the sky and over every living creature that moves on the ground.’ 


Then God said, ‘I give you every seed-bearing plant on the face of the whole earth and every tree that has fruit with seed in it. They will be yours for food. And to all the beasts of the earth and all the birds in the sky and all the creatures that move along the ground – everything that has the breath of life in it – I give every green plant for food.’ And it was so. 


God saw all that he had made, and it was very good. 


And there was evening, and there was morning – the sixth day.
